Expand Map
Multimedia in Paris, IL
1. PM Productions
319 S Prospect Av, Champaign, IL 61820
OPEN NOW:10:00 am - 5:00 pm
From Business: PM Productions is located in Champaign, Illinois and serving the surrounding area. We have over 30 years experience in television production, directing and editing. We also do…
43 Years
in Business
2. Pavlor Media
1207 W Nevada St, Urbana, IL 61801
3. LaDraggo
39 Martinsville St, Greencastle, IN 46135
CLOSED NOW:10:00 am - 5:00 pm
11 Years
in Business
Showing 1-3 of 3